During the American Civil War, artillery sergeants had command of, and responsibility for, the men and equipment of a platoon. A full strength battery normally had between 4 to 6 guns with each gun having a sergeant. The sergeant made sure that all of the cannoneers and drivers were properly trained in each role necessary to service a piece so that they could switch roles on an individual basis if casualties occurred. He was to: follow, repeat, and carry out the section chief ’s orders promptly; insure that the gunner selected the correct target and used the proper range and projectile; and check that the chief of caisson was prepared to bring forward ammunition as necessary.

William Britain, W. Britain or simply Britain's, no matter what we are called our name is synonymous with toy soldiers. Since 1893 W. Britain has been producing toy soldiers and military miniatures with attention to detail, quality and authenticity. Each model figure is cast out of metal and hand painted to the highest possible standards. Our ranges include traditional toy style figures in 1/32 scale (54mm / 2.125" tall) and a large selection of realistic matte finished figures in 1/30 scale (58mm / 2.3125" tall). Most major time periods are covered from the eighteenth century up to the conflicts of the twentieth century. Whatever your interest, W. Britain has figures and accessories for your collection!
